jQuery MiniUI

标题: treegrid加载数据问题 [打印本页]

作者: miniui寒东    时间: 2013-11-6 09:33:49     标题: treegrid加载数据问题

亲们:为什么在treegrid里用grid.setData()的方法能加载进去数据,但显示不出父子节点的关系呢?数据格式对的,直接用url链接是可以的

作者: gyc1105    时间: 2013-11-6 09:38:00

treegrid 加载好像只能用url加载,其他方式加载数据显示不出来
作者: lost    时间: 2013-11-6 09:40:52

resultAsTree="false/true"试试
作者: miniui寒东    时间: 2013-11-6 09:45:40

gyc1105 发表于 2013-11-6 09:38
treegrid 加载好像只能用url加载,其他方式加载数据显示不出来

不会吧 我能加载进来数据,可是显示不出树形的层级关系 都在一列上
作者: factory    时间: 2013-11-6 09:53:29

miniui寒东 发表于 2013-11-6 09:45
不会吧 我能加载进来数据,可是显示不出树形的层级关系 都在一列上

看你数据是什么格式的

列表状的,给treegrid加上resultAsTree="false"
作者: gyc1105    时间: 2013-11-6 09:55:33

miniui寒东 发表于 2013-11-6 09:45
不会吧 我能加载进来数据,可是显示不出树形的层级关系 都在一列上

我遇到的情况是这样的
treeGrid只能url加载
用loadData方式加载上来的数据是没有层级关系,
用load没问题
用loadList 也是没有层级关系
作者: factory    时间: 2013-11-6 10:20:30

gyc1105 发表于 2013-11-6 09:55
我遇到的情况是这样的
treeGrid只能url加载
用loadData方式加载上来的数据是没有层级关系,

看你是什么样的数据啊
loadData()必须是树形的数据

如果是列表的.必须用loadList,并且需要加上idField和parentField
loadList ( Array, idField, parentField )
作者: miniui寒东    时间: 2013-11-6 10:23:36

gyc1105 发表于 2013-11-6 09:55
我遇到的情况是这样的
treeGrid只能url加载
用loadData方式加载上来的数据是没有层级关系,

亲,用load也不行啊
作者: miniui寒东    时间: 2013-11-6 10:24:22

lost 发表于 2013-11-6 09:40
resultAsTree="false/true"试试

我试了下,还是不行的哦
作者: factory    时间: 2013-11-6 10:25:32

miniui寒东 发表于 2013-11-6 10:24
我试了下,还是不行的哦

看你是什么样的数据啊
loadData()必须是树形的数据

如果是列表的.必须用loadList,并且需要加上idField和parentField
loadList ( Array, idField, parentField )
作者: miniui寒东    时间: 2013-11-6 16:42:07

factory 发表于 2013-11-6 10:25
看你是什么样的数据啊
loadData()必须是树形的数据

谢谢了,我试过了这个方法,可以的,不过我误解了您的意思,传进来的Array应该是一组对象的集合




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2